Impacting Cancer with HPC: Opportunities and Challenges
SESSION: Impacting Cancer with HPC: Opportunities and Challenges
EVENT TYPE: Birds of a Feather
EVENT TAG(S): Applications, Analytics
TIME: 1:30PM - 3:00PM
SESSION LEADER(S):Eric A. Stahlberg, Patricia Kovatch, Thomas Barr
ROOM:15
ABSTRACT:
High-performance computing and HPC technologies have long been employed in multiple roles in cancer research and clinical applications. The importance of HPC in medical applications has been recently highlighted with the announcement of the National Strategic Computing Initiative. Despite the broad impact of HPC on cancer, no venue has been present to specifically bring together the SC community around this topic. This BoF session will focus on bringing together those with an interest in furthering the impact of HPC on cancer, providing overviews of application areas and technologies, opportunities and challenges, while providing for in-depth interactive discussion across interest areas.
